UTD (Bit 11): Undertemperature During Discharge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
UTC (Bit 10): Undertemperature During Charge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
OTD (Bit 9): Overtemperature During Discharge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
OTC (Bit 8): Overtemperature During Charge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
ASCDL (Bit 7): Short Circuit During Discharge Latch
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
ASCD (Bit 6): Short Circuit During Discharge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
AOLDL (Bit 5): Overload During Discharge Latch
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
AOLD (Bit 4): Overload During Discharge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
OCD (Bit 3): Overcurrent During Discharge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
OCC (Bit 2): Overcurrent During Charge
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
COV (Bit 1): Cell Overvoltage
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
CUV (Bit 0): Cell Undervoltage
1 = Detected
0 = Not Detected
17.2.35 ManufacturerAccess() 0x0051 SafetyStatus
This command returns the SafetyStatus() flags on ManufacturerBlockAccess() or ManufacturerData().
